373 DON'T BE TEMPTED The Traffic Jimp sometimes comes indoors. He may disguise himself as a hospitable friend. "Just a little one!" he says. "One won't hurt you." It may hurt you or someone else very badly indeed. Like the Jimp, alcohol deceives. You may feel you are driving well —but in fact your alertness is dulled, your reactions slowed. Don't risk it. Don't drive when you're tired — and don't try to cure tiredness with a drink. Remember the Highway Code — and mind how you go. Issued by the Ministry of Transport JUST ONE FOR THE ROAD.
